Bend in the hood

Hey guys, I have almost no experience with body work but I picked up an Iroc hood at the junkyard this weekend for $27 with just one bend in the corner where the headlights are. Could someone explain to me how I can do a good job fixing this or point me to a tutorial that would help? I'll upload a pic so you know what I'm dealing with. Thanks!

Re: Bend in the hood

id bend it back the best i coud and then get a base of duraglass and go thin with the body filler. easily fixable

Re: Bend in the hood

Use a hammer and dolly to get it as straight as possible. Watch out for oil can!
